Benton woman turns herself in for shooting of two at Tyndall
UPDATE OCT 13, 2022 A woman has turned herself in for the shooting of two adults at Tyndall Park in Benton. Benton Police Department responded to Tyndall Park on the evening of September 20th for reports of shots fired. American Legion Post Number 19 Hosting 2nd annual Pancake Breakfast October 15th
American Legion Post Number 19 will host their 2nd annual Pancake Breakfast Fundraiser. Come to this event between 7:30 and 9:00 a.m. on Saturday October 15th at the Republican headquarters in downtown Benton. The address is 125 N. Market Street. Pancakes will be prepared by Serge Krikorian with Vibrant Occasions catering.
